GM, what $ZKTR'll build today?
Adding Email OTP to zkAuth Layer 2 security - but fully decentralized.
No database. No centralized storage. Just math.
How it works:
- Request OTP → server generates code + signed token
- Token contains hash + expiry + signature
- OTP sent to your second / other email
- Enter code → server verifies token signature, done
The "state" lives in the token itself. Stateless verification. Zero storage dependency.
True decentralized 2FA.

How zkAuth Works
zkAuth is fully decentralized authentication. No passwords, no databases, no server secrets.
Your master key is split across 3 blockchains. You only need 2 to recover.
